Counting Cornucopias
Counting cornucopias is a fun and festive way to practice basic counting skills with your preschooler. These worksheets typically feature a variety of different fruits and vegetables spilling out of a cornucopia, with numbers next to each item for your child to count. You can challenge your child by asking them to count how many apples, pumpkins, or ears of corn are in the cornucopia, helping them develop their number recognition and counting abilities. To make the activity even more engaging, consider incorporating real fruits and vegetables for your child to count along with the worksheet.
Turkey Math
Turkey math worksheets are another popular option for Thanksgiving-themed counting activities. These worksheets often feature adorable turkey characters with numbers on their feathers for your child to count. Your preschooler can practice counting by adding up the numbers on each turkey’s feathers or by counting how many turkeys are on the page. To make the activity even more interactive, consider using small turkey cutouts or stickers that your child can move around as they count. This hands-on approach can help your child develop their fine motor skills while practicing their math abilities in a fun and creative way.
